January 24, 2022. tampa’s most prized tradition was sparked 118 years ago and continues to be shrouded in some mystery. gasparilla, the city’s most popular annual event, centered around a pirate themed parade, resulted from a conversation seeking to spice up an existing parade. it all started in the newsroom of the now defunct tampa morning. The tampa bay area's annual pirate festival, gasparilla, first began in 1904 when the ye mystic krewe of gasparilla (ymkg) planned a surprise "mock pirate attack" on tampa.

The gasparilla pirate festival (often simply referred to as gasparilla[1] ˌɡæspəˈrɪlə ⓘ) is a large parade and a host of related community events held in tampa, florida, united states, most years since 1904.
